About this job:
- Research evaluate and perform technical and economic analysis on energy efficiency technologies projects and programs considering customer experience and impact
- Perform computer-related functions such as engineering analysis spreadsheet development utilization and manipulation and database compilations
- Evaluate both high-level program implications and detailed project-level factors including accounting reviews cost-effectiveness analysis and market strategies
- Compile and write technical reports
- Provide input on program planning design acquisition targets and budgets for DSM/USB projects and programs
- Maintain accurate DSM/USB program records databases and documentation
- Function as either a primary or supporting contact for DSM/USB programs
- Interact with and provide information to NorthWestern Energys external technical advisory committees and other parties as necessary
- Develop and manage requests for proposals evaluate bids and negotiate contracts and manage contractor performance
- Monitor program performance relative to established acquisition targets and budgets
- Support the development of DSM/USB regulatory filings

Am I right for this job Heres the success profile:
- Demonstrate and maintain a good safety record
- Bachelors degree in engineering required
- Current Professional Engineers License or ability to obtain one is preferred
- An interest in mechanical work and/or relevant experience is preferred.
- Ability to work independently as well as in a team environment
- Flexible and proactive able to adapt to changing priorities and committed to consistently providing excellent customer service
- General understanding of natural gas and electric utility systems preferred
- Familiarity with underlying concepts as well as challenges associated with utility-operated DSM programs
- Good working knowledge of economic analysis and energy-related concepts and calculations
- Knowledge of current Montana building codes is preferred
- Working knowledge and experience in construction and design preferred
- Working knowledge and experience with residential and commercial lighting heating ventilating and air conditioning equipment design installation and maintenance
- Demonstrate experience with Microsoft Office Package (Word Excel Access PowerPoint etc.)
